1996 Chevrolet Astro Passenger Pricing

1996 Chevrolet Astro Passenger pricing starts at $2,591 for the Astro Passenger Minivan, which had a starting MSRP of $19,736 when new. The range-topping 1996 Astro Passenger Minivan starts at $2,591 today, originally priced from $19,736.

Astro Passenger Consumer Sentiment

Owners give this generation Chevrolet Astro Passenger (1995-2005) a 4.2 out of 5 rating, which is higher than most, and 89% recommend it. These figures are based on 389 consumer reviews, like these:

What Owners are Saying About the 1996 Chevrolet Astro Passenger

"Comfortable seating plus cargo space"

"Bought vehicle new for this model is only one found that had cargo space for Zodiac, motor, and related paraphernalia and still carry 7 adults. RV friends caravanned with us, but we usually drove when group went sight-seeing. Has drivetrain disconnect so could be towed behind the motorhome, therefore, has 20K to 25K additional miles since odometer does not record towed miles."

1996 Astro Passenger Safety

NHTSA Safety Rating

According to the National Highway Traffic Safety Administration (NHTSA), the 1996 Chevrolet Astro Passenger front-side driver crash test rating is 3 out of 5 stars. The front-side passenger crash test rating is 3 out of 5.

1996 Chevrolet Astro Depreciation

Annual Depreciation is an estimation of what your vehicle's value might be over time based on an average of similar vehicles. Estimations are calculated by comparing Kelley Blue Book Private Party Values of vehicles similar to yours over time, as well as forecasts from Manheim Auction data comparing current and projected auction values against current Kelley Blue Book Private Party and Trade-In Values. This is not a guarantee of actual depreciation. Local weather conditions, market factors and driver performance will also impact your vehicle's actual depreciation.
